Lasseter: 'Cars 2 will be a road movie'
Published Thursday, Jul 30 2009, 01:04 BST | By Tim Parks

The original animated picture focused on the adventures of Lightning McQueen (voiced by Owen Wilson), a race car who detours into the small town of Radiator Springs.
Lasseter told Sci-Fi Wire that the first film's entire gang of cars will be heading out on the highway in Cars 2.
He said: "It's Radiator Springs, and then the characters go to other places as well."
The filmmaker also revealed that a decision had not been made whether or not to recast the late Paul Newman's Doc Hudson character, adding: "We haven't really [addressed it yet]. We're still working on that".
Cars 2 is scheduled to open in cinemas in 2011.
